前言
在这个数字化时代,网络已经成为了我们生活中不可或缺的一部分。而网页,作为网络世界的主要表现形式,其重要性不言而喻。掌握前端开发,意味着你可以亲手打造出独一无二的个性化网页,让你的创意在网络世界中绽放光彩。本文将带领你从零基础开始,逐步深入学习前端开发的精髓,让你成为一名合格的前端开发者。
第一部分:前端开发基础
1.1 什么是前端开发?
前端开发,顾名思义,就是负责网页的外观和用户交互的部分。它包括HTML、CSS和JavaScript三大核心技术。
1.2 HTML:网页的结构
HTML(HyperText Markup Language)是网页的基础,它定义了网页的结构和内容。学习HTML,你需要掌握以下内容:
- 基本的标签使用
- 布局结构(如div、span、ul、li等)
- 表单元素(如input、select、textarea等)
- 常用标签的属性和用法
1.3 CSS:网页的样式
CSS(Cascading Style Sheets)负责网页的样式,如颜色、字体、布局等。学习CSS,你需要掌握以下内容:
- 选择器(如id、class、标签选择器等)
- 常用样式属性(如color、font、margin、padding等)
- 布局技术(如float、flex、grid等)
- 响应式设计(适配不同设备和屏幕尺寸)
1.4 JavaScript:网页的交互
JavaScript是一种编程语言,用于实现网页的动态效果和交互功能。学习JavaScript,你需要掌握以下内容:
- 基本语法和数据类型
- 函数和对象
- DOM操作
- 事件处理
- 常用库和框架(如jQuery、Vue、React等)
第二部分:前端开发进阶
2.1 版本控制
版本控制是前端开发中不可或缺的一环,它可以帮助你管理代码版本,方便团队协作。常用的版本控制系统有Git和SVN。
2.2 预处理器
预处理器如Sass和Less可以提高CSS的编写效率,让样式更加简洁易读。
2.3 模板引擎
模板引擎如EJS和Pug可以帮助你快速生成HTML代码,提高开发效率。
2.4 打包工具
打包工具如Webpack和Gulp可以帮助你自动化前端开发流程,如代码压缩、合并等。
第三部分:实战项目
3.1 个人博客
通过搭建个人博客,你可以将所学的前端知识应用到实际项目中,提高自己的实践能力。
3.2 在线商城
在线商城项目可以让你深入了解前端开发的各个方面,如产品展示、购物车、订单管理等。
3.3 游戏开发
游戏开发是前端开发的一个分支,通过学习游戏开发,你可以掌握更多的前端技术,如Canvas、WebGL等。
结语
学习前端开发是一个不断积累和提升的过程。通过本文的学习,相信你已经对前端开发有了更深入的了解。接下来,你需要付出更多的努力,不断实践和总结,才能成为一名优秀的前端开发者。让我们一起努力,打造属于你的个性化网页吧!
